About the Role

The Student Support team play a key role in supporting the engagement and retention of our Dental students across all years of study.

They are responsible for day to day enquiry handling for all Dental students. The Student Support Administrator will act as a referral point to provide students with support, guidance, information and impartial advice. The post holder will work collaboratively with the Student Support Team to ensure high quality delivery of administrative and support services to stakeholders, both internally and externally.

The primary goal is to uphold and coordinate student administration systems and processes to enhance the student experience and academic cycle of activities.  You will support the Student Support Manager and Academic lead for Student Support with administration tasks, oversee the shared inbox responding to students and staff in a timely manner and support the running of the Staff Student Liaison Committee, the induction cycle and welcome week.
